Transaction d33e85191e9595fa3b3aa0f2fa735d770d351eae4fdbb189de3fdad49ff59599

block
9afbf7331a2305a62c31c9cc8690a1ebbf88033b192a605704d735d516cf1964

1 Input

25 Outputs